Exploration Division seeks to discover and exploit the science that no one has done before.

The pace of technological change requires the UK to constantly adapt, experiment and take risks, in order to preserve the UK’s strategic advantage. Dstl’s Exploration Division focuses on finding defence and security solutions with that edge – whether in technology, concepts or strategies – then proving that they work and showing others how to exploit them.

We work to understand advances in science and technology wherever they occur, and test to see what they may mean for defence and security – either in using the new development ourselves, or being affected by it.

Our people build the evidence-base for how defence can operate now and into the future, and help senior people with decision-making.

We help bring problems to life in different ways, from running wargames in which we find out what the right mix of forces will be for the next 10 or more years, to devising and testing approaches to understand how we can better command forces in the field.

We develop and apply the science around influencing human behaviour, showing how the UK can achieve strategic, operational and tactical influence through words, images and actions.

Exploration Division has specialist groups that each take the lead on a specific aspect of our work.

Strategic and Operational Analysis

The Strategic and  Operational Analysis group identifies, understands, structures and assesses complex defence and security problems using our systems skills, soft operational research (OR) and strategic analysis expertise. We develop pathways to promote change, influence decisions and guide problem owners on implementation for the future.

The group is responsible for:

  • strategic analysis (providing evidence-based expertise and analytical support on strategy and policy across DstlMOD and wider government)
  • policy and strategy analysis (providing independent research, analysis and advice to enable high-level, senior decision-makers, primarily in MOD Head Office, concerning defence policy and strategy)
  • systems thinking and consultancy (applying systems thinking, technical consultancy and facilitation techniques to complex problems across defence and security)
  • co-ordination and stewardship of the Support to Operations (S2O) OR capability for Exploration Division

Behavioural and Social Science

The group identifies, champions and applies multidisciplinary behavioural and social science expertise supporting our stakeholders to understand, predict and influence behaviour of individuals and groups.

The group focuses on:

  • human influence, applying social science to UK defence and security and wider government in order to understand, predict and influence human behaviour (for example, Information Activities and Outreach, and Human Interaction)
  • behavioural research, applying behavioural science to UK defence and security and wider government in order to enhance understanding of human relationships (for example, Security Social Science and Criminology)
  • social and cultural research, providing UK defence and security and wider government with a deep understanding of cultural and environmental influences and practices (for example, Applied Linguistics, Anthropology and Ethics)

Future Concepts Evaluation

The Future Concepts Evaluation Group develops and applies operational research methods (including wargaming, modelling and simulation) to assess defence and security policies, strategies, concepts and force structures.

We evaluate the implications of employing generation-after-next science and technology on the future force. We also identify where new concepts may have benefit and where promotion and adoption of transformative ideas should be pursued further.

The group focuses on:

  • strategic gaming and historical analysis (developing and applying wargaming, operational research approaches and historical analysis techniques to conduct strategic and policy level assessment of options and concepts)
  • force structure analysis (providing cost analysis, and conducting force structure level assessment using modelling, wargaming and other operational research approaches)
  • campaign development and analysis (developing scenarios for campaign context, carrying out campaign-level assessment and maintaining campaign models)
  • force effectiveness wargaming and simulation (conducting operational-level assessment of options and concepts using wargaming and simulation techniques)
  • tactical wargaming and simulation (conducting tactical level assessment of options and concepts using wargaming and simulation)
  • wargaming advice, research and development

Transformative Techniques and Technologies

The Transformative Techniques and Technologies group leads activity relating to novel strategies, concepts, systems and technologies through the use of transformative tools, techniques and ways of working. We use software development, data science and analytics, transformative technologies and the human-digital environments to get the most out of them.

This group works on:

  • data science and analytics (the focus for the division’s data science and analytics technical expertise)
  • data exploitation (championing the exploitation of data science and analytics across defence and security)
  • data science enablement (facilitating the adoption of data science and analytics through data engineering and skills development)
  • software engineering and model development
  • future training (research into potential future transformative technologies and approaches for training, mission rehearsal and education)
  • novel simulation for training (research into new approaches to simulation for training and other applications such as mission rehearsal and wargaming)

Futures and Innovation

The Futures and Innovation Group is the hub for science and technology futures and incubator expertise. Our goals are to:

  • understand the future context, enabling defence and security to meet over-the-horizon challenges and opportunities
  • imagine and develop transformative technologies, concepts and systems
  • identify, assess and provide advice on emerging trends, capabilities and technologies

This is achieved by:

  • insights (identifying, assessing and advising on emerging capabilities and technologies, applying systems approaches, horizon scanning and technology roadmapping, and knowledge management for futures)
  • transformative concepts and systems (developing understanding of the long-term future context and operating environment, the impact of generation after next technologies, and imagining and developing transformative concepts and systems)
  • research and concepts promotion (a centre for futures engagement and coherence that explores and promotes opportunities, concepts and capabilities to shape defence and security)
  • futures capability development (developing and identifies new approaches to futures analysis, promoting their use to the wider futures community, and embedding the use of futures in defence and security)

Project Delivery

The Project Delivery Group provides project and programme professionals as well as specialist roles such as finance, commercial and assurance, to support the delivery of Exploration division’s innovative work.
